Posted on 00:07 Hrs,November 14th, 2006 by O

Brandon Vera fights the former UFC Heavy Weight Champ, Frank Mir on 11/18. I think Frank Mir will be KFO’d in the 2nd round. In a recent interview, Brandon mentions the Philippines numerous times.

Short term goals is to keep my health, go to the Philippines. Start concentrating on my businesses, I have a couple different businesses that I’m doing. After this fight I’m going to go ahead and reinvest and start actually do things with what I’ve been supposed to be doing. Instead of floating along.

I guess that he will open some MMA schools in Manila. He’s already been there numerous times for some seminars.
